  • Patent number: 10932012
    Abstract: A video player that can launch a program from the video player while a video relating to the program (for example, a tutorial video) is being played. Also, a video player that can start a video location at a time location that is determined by a program location currently being executed by a computer program being run by the user. In order to do these things, a mapping is maintained between time ranges in the video and program locations to which the time ranges of the video respectively relate.

  • Patent number: 10885127
    Abstract: A method, computer program product, and a system where a processor(s) monitors communications between one or more clients to a query engine, to identify requests to execute queries on the database resource. Based on identifying a requested query, the processor(s) applies cognitive analysis algorithms to parse components of the requested query, to identify components in the requested query that indicate an execution success measure for the requested query. The processor(s) determines the execution success measure for the requested query and assigns an execution action to the requested query: pre-empting the requested query or executing the requested query. The processor(s) facilitates this action on the requested query.

  • Patent number: 10497397
    Abstract: A method, system and computer readable media are provided to generate short video notes (v-notes) from one or more videos. A series of inputs including playback commands from a user is received. By utilizing a machine learning system, the received inputs can be analyzed for video content to identify which portions are of importance. A customized v-note, smaller in size than the one or more videos, may be generated by aggregating the identified portions of video content from the one or more videos, wherein the v-note is customized to the user, based upon received inputs from the user.

  • Patent number: 10255324
    Abstract: Disclosed aspects relate to automated query modification in a database management system (DBMS). A triggering event related to an execution of a query may be detected by an automated query modification engine. A query modification operation may be determined by the automated query modification engine based on a nature of the triggering event. The query modification operation may be determined to debug the triggering event related to the execution of the query. The query modification operation may be carried-out by the automated query modification engine. The query modification operation may be carried-out to modify the query to debug the triggering event related to the execution of the query.
